In many roles at High Cotton Homes, particularly those requiring specialized knowledge or research capabilities (e.g., certain engineering, scientific, or financial roles), an advanced degree like a Master's or PhD can lead to a higher starting salary and faster career progression, thus higher earnings. However, for some roles, direct experience and skills might be valued as much or more than an advanced degree. The impact varies by field and specific job requirements.
Florence's Cost of Living Index is approximately 76.9 (23.1% less expensive than US average; 6.6% less than AL average). This significantly impacts the purchasing power of a salary from High Cotton Homes based there.
